What to Consider Before Buying

1. Size and Portability

  • Compact Design: Ideal for small apartments or home offices.
  • Foldable Options: Some walking pads fold completely in half for under-bed storage.
  • Weight: Lightweight models are easier to move but may have lower weight capacity.

2. Speed Range

  • Walking Only: Many pads are capped at 3–4 mph.
  • Jogging Friendly: Advanced models may go up to 6 mph.
  • Purpose Matters: If you need light exercise while working, low-speed pads are fine. For cardio workouts, choose higher-speed models.

3. Weight Capacity

  • Most smart walking pads support 220–300 lbs.
  • Always check this spec for safety and durability.

4. Noise Level

  • A quiet motor is essential if you plan to use it in an office, shared space, or while taking calls.

5. Smart Features

  • App Connectivity: Sync with fitness apps to track distance, calories, and progress.
  • Remote Control: Adjust speed without bending over.
  • LED Display: Shows speed, steps, time, and calories.

6. Safety Features

  • Auto-stop sensors for sudden stops.
  • Non-slip belts for secure walking.
  • Child lock modes on certain models.

7. Durability

  • Look for high-quality materials and motors that can handle daily use.
  • Warranty coverage may indicate long-term reliability.

8. Price Range

  • Entry-level models are affordable but limited in features.
  • Higher-end walking pads offer better shock absorption, faster speeds, and app controls.

Comparison Table: Walking Pad vs. Treadmill

FeatureSmart Walking PadTraditional Treadmill
SizeCompact, foldableLarge, bulky
Speed Range0.5–6 mph0.5–12 mph
NoiseQuietLouder
StorageUnder bed/deskRequires dedicated space
Best ForWalking, light joggingRunning, high-intensity workouts

FAQs

Q1: Can I use a smart walking pad under a standing desk?
Yes, many users pair walking pads with standing desks for “walk-and-work” setups.

Q2: How much space does a walking pad need?
Most are about 48–55 inches long and 20–25 inches wide, making them ideal for small spaces.

Q3: Are walking pads safe for seniors?
Yes, especially models with slower speeds, auto-stop sensors, and non-slip belts.

Q4: Can walking pads replace running treadmills?
No, they are designed for walking and light jogging only. If you’re a runner, a full treadmill is better.

Q5: Do I need to assemble a smart walking pad?
Most come pre-assembled—simply unbox, unfold (if foldable), and plug in.
